We investigate the effect of a charged Higgs boson (H^\pm) on the decays D^\pm_s\to \mu^\pm\nu and D^\pm_s\to \tau^\pm\nu, which will be measured with high precision at forthcoming CLEO-c. We show that a H^\pm can suppress the branching ratios by 10% \to 15% from the Standard Model prediction, and we emphasize that such contributions should not be overlooked when comparing lattice calculations of f_{D_s} to the values obtained from these decays.
